Casey Duncan wrote:
> A Zope "library" is a collection of components distributed together. It
> probably isn't useful on it's own, but it might include an example
> application or two. We could also call these "bundles" I suppose, but
> I'm unsure why a new word needs to be used. To me "library" fits. A
> "library" is a bit more than a Python "package" (since it contains some
> Zope-isms like interfaces, zcml, page templates or other zope
> dependancies) and would follow the Zope conventions for layout and
> naming.

My understanding is that a bundle is a library or application archived 
in a single file for easy distribution.  A bundle must be unpacked to 
use it.  The contents of a bundle may span multiple Python packages, I 
think.
